Gravel Parking Lot Grading in Atlanta, GA
Gravel parking lot grading services involve shaping and leveling the surface to ensure proper drainage, stability, and durability. This process typically includes removing uneven spots, filling low areas, and establishing a gentle slope to prevent water pooling and erosion. Property owners often request gravel grading for driveways, parking areas, or access roads to improve safety, reduce mud and dust, and extend the lifespan of the gravel surface. Before requesting grading services, homeowners should consider the current condition of the lot, the desired drainage pattern, and any specific concerns about runoff or surface stability.
Understanding the scope of gravel parking lot grading is essential for property owners planning a project. It’s helpful to know whether the existing surface requires simple leveling or more extensive reshaping, as well as the size of the area involved. Clarifying the intended use of the space and any specific drainage or maintenance needs can also guide the grading process. Proper grading ensures the gravel surface remains functional and safe, supporting long-term use and minimizing future repairs.

Gravel Parking Lot Grading Questions
What is gravel parking lot grading? Gravel parking lot grading involves leveling and shaping the surface to ensure proper drainage and stability for vehicles.
Why is grading important for gravel lots? Proper grading prevents water pooling, reduces erosion, and extends the lifespan of the parking area.
What projects typically require gravel parking lot grading? Projects include new parking lot installation, resurfacing existing lots, and improving drainage for better usability.
How does grading improve parking lot safety? It creates a smooth, even surface that minimizes the risk of uneven spots and potholes for vehicles and pedestrians.
